Jan. 01, 1971 - Apollo 14 LLTV; Astronaut Alan B. Shepard stands near a Lunar Landing Training Vehicle (LLTV) priors to a test flight at the Ellington Air Force Base. Shepard is the commander of the Apollo 14 lunar landing mission. He will be at the controls of the Apollo 14 Lunar Module when it lands on the Moon in the highlands near Fra Mauro. Astronaut Stuart A. Roosa, command module pilot, will remain with the Apollo 14 Command and Service modules in lunar orbit whilst astronauts Shepard and Edgar D. Mitchell lunar module pilot, descent in the LM to explore the Moon
